Visualizing our dreams

未来AI或能帮人们记录梦境

After waking up, you may feel frustrated that you cannot recall the dreams you had last night.

如果醒来后记不得昨晚做的梦,你可能会觉得沮丧,

Artificial intelligence (AI) may be able to help.

而人工智能(AI)或许可以帮上忙。

Previously, there have been AI models that can turn text into images.

此前,研究人员已创建出能够将文本转换为图像的AI模型,

They can do this by learning from a large amount of data from both tests and images.

AI可以学习来自测试和图像中的大量数据,从而实现转换。

This time, researchers from Osaka University in Japan have trained an AI system called Stable Diffusion

据《科学》杂志报道,这一次,日本大阪大学的研究团队训练了一个名为“稳定扩散”的AI模型,

to re-create images based on people’s brain scans, reported Science magazine.

基于人们的大脑扫描再生成图像。

The researchers used an online data set provided by the University of Minnesota, US,

研究人员使用了美国明尼苏达大学提供的在线数据集,

which consisted of brain scans from four participants as they each viewed a set of 10,000 photos.

其中包括4名参与者观看10000张照片时的脑部扫描结果,

The scans were recorded by functional magnetic resonance imaging (fMRI).

该结果由功能性磁共振成像(fMRI)记录。

The AI then learned about the brain activities by analyzing changes in blood flow shown by the fMRI data –

随后,AI通过分析fMRI数据显示的血流变化了解大脑活动——

when a part of the brain is activated, more blood will flow to it.

大脑的一部分激活时,会有更多的血液流向该区域,

It then matched the brain activities with the photos.

而后便能将大脑活动与照片相匹配。

Through this method, AI learned how human brains would react when seeing different photos.

通过这种方法,AI了解到人类大脑观看不同照片时的反应。

Finally, the researchers tested the AI on additional brain scans from the same participants when they viewed photos of a toy bear,airplane, clock and train.

最后,研究人员对其进行了额外的脑部扫描,在同一批参与者观看玩具熊、飞机、时钟和火车的照片时。

If the person looked at an airplane, for example, the AI would use the brain scan data to create an image of a very blurry airplane.

例如,一个人看着一架飞机时,AI会使用大脑扫描数据生成一个非常模糊的飞机图像。

Then, it would turn on the previous “text-to-image” model and improve the quality of the image by feeding itself the keyword “airplane”.

然后,AI会启动之前的“文本转图像”模型,并给自己“喂”下“飞机”这一关键词,以提高图像的质量。

The final images were “convincing” with about 80 percent of accuracy, according to the researchers.

据研究人员称,最终得到的图像“几可乱真”,且准确率高达约80%。

The new study created a novel approach that incorporates texts and images to “decipher the brain”,

这项新研究创造了一种结合文本和图像来“破译”大脑的新方法,

Ariel Goldstein from Princeton University, US, told Science magazine.

美国普林斯顿大学的科学家Ariel Goldstein在接受《科学》杂志采访时表示。

In the future, scientists hope that the technology can be used to record imagined thoughts and dreams

未来,科研人员们希望这项技术可以用来记录幻想和梦境,

or allow people to understand how differently other animals perceive reality.

或是让人们了解其他动物对现实的感知有何不同。
